Grace Tuxedo Park, Indianapolis, IN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Grace Tuxedo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Grace Tuxedo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$857 | $539 | $1,159 |
| Grace Tuxedo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$998 | $648 | $1,396 |
| Grace Tuxedo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,089 | $875 | $1,350 |
| Grace Tuxedo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,072 | $895 | $1,250 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Grace Tuxedo Park
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Grace Tuxedo Park c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Grace Tuxedo Park range from $648 to $1,396.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$998.
How expensive are Grace Tuxedo Park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 11 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Grace Tuxedo Park on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$875 to $1,350 - averaging $1,089 for the location.
